User Specified Search Field

You may search on any column listed below. Where reasonable, the table lists the range of valid values or a set of sample values. A description of the column is also given. Note the column "label" is the name displayed on the search forms and in search results. The column "name" is the actual column name in the table and needs to be specified in GET requests.

From a MAST search form, simply select the column "label" in the forms pulldown menu and type in the qualification in the adjacent box. Note that if you specify constraints on the same column in more than one form element, they will all be included in the query and you may not get results you expect. In a HTTP GET request, specify the column "name" in the service request. (See the MAST Services web page for information on sumbitting GET requests.)

sci_crowdsap crowding The ratio of target flux to total flux in optimal aperture. This value is not to be confused with the Crowding values given on the Target Search page which give predictive values. currently all null float
sci_contamination contamination 1.0 - the crowding value currently all null float
sci_flfrcsap flux fraction The fraction of target flux obtained in the optimal aperture averaged for the specified data. The flux fraction in any given cadence will differ from this mean value. This value is not to be confused with the Flux Fraction value given on the Target Search page which gives a predictive values. currently all null float
sci_Cdpp3_0 cdpp3 The RMS Combined Differential Photometric Precision (CDPP) time series calculated by the Kepler pipeline for a transit duration of length 3-hrs over a single quarter, in units of parts per million. currently all null float
sci_Cdpp6_0 cdpp6 RMS Combined Differential Photometric Precision (CDPP) on 6.0-hour time scales in units of parts per million. currently all null float
sci_Cdpp12_0 cdpp12 RMS Combined Differential Photometric Precision (CDPP) on 12-hour time scales in units of parts per million. currently all null float
